3D printing turns a digital file into a real, solid plastic part — one thin layer at a time. At Dan3DStudio we run two of the most popular technologies side by side: FDM (fused deposition modeling) and resin (SLA / MSLA). If you've never ordered a 3D print before, this page is written for you: we'll explain what each process does best, what it costs to think about, and how to send us a file that actually works.

FDM is the workhorse. A spool of thermoplastic filament is melted and squeezed through a nozzle that traces your part layer by layer. It's tough, cost-effective, and comes in dozens of engineering materials. If you need a bracket, a housing, a jig, a mount, a replacement knob, a drone frame, or anything else that has to survive real-world use, FDM is almost always the right call.

Resin printing is the detail specialist. A vat of liquid photopolymer is cured with UV light, one paper-thin layer at a time. The result is smooth surfaces, crisp edges, and features so fine your eye can't see the layer lines. Miniatures, jewelry masters, dental models, cosmetic prototypes, and figurines all live in resin territory.

When to choose FDM vs. resin

Ask yourself two questions. First: does this part need to be strong and take a beating, or does it need to look beautiful? Second: how big is it? Anything larger than about 15 cm on a side, or anything that will be bolted, screwed, or dropped, usually belongs in FDM. Small, detailed, decorative or optical parts belong in resin.

FDM parts can be printed in PLA (easy, biodegradable), PETG (tough and weather-resistant), ABS or ASA (heat and UV resistant), and reinforced blends like ABS-CF, PA12-CF, and ASA-CF, which mix chopped carbon fiber into the plastic for stiffness comparable to some metals at a fraction of the weight. We tune infill, wall count, and layer height to match the load your part will actually see.

Resin parts come out of the printer wet and need to be washed and UV-cured before use. We handle every post-processing step in-house so what you receive is a finished piece — supports removed, alcohol-washed, cured, and inspected. Standard resins are rigid; tough resins bend before they snap; castable resins burn out cleanly for jewelry and dental casting.

How the process works, from file to finished part

Step one: send us a file. STL, STEP, OBJ, 3MF, or even a native SolidWorks or Fusion 360 file all work. No file? Send photos with a ruler in the frame, or a hand sketch with the important dimensions — our CAD team can build the model for you.

Step two: engineering review. We open your file, check wall thickness, look for features that will fail on the printer, confirm the orientation that gives you the best surface finish and strength, and quote materials and turnaround. If something looks risky we flag it before we hit print, not after.

Step three: production. We slice, print, and post-process. FDM parts are trimmed of any support material; resin parts are washed, cured, and cleaned. Tolerances are ±0.05 mm for FDM and ±0.02 mm for resin under typical conditions.

Step four: quality check and shipping. Every part is inspected against your file. Local Dallas–Fort Worth customers can pick up; national customers get shipped, often within a day or two of the order.

What it costs and how to get a fair quote

Print pricing is driven by three things: material used, machine time, and post-processing. A small clip might be a few dollars; a complex fixture that runs the printer overnight is more. Because we quote from your actual file rather than an online calculator, you get a real number based on how the part actually prints — not a worst-case guess.

If you're on a tight budget, tell us. We can often re-orient, hollow out, or change infill to bring cost down without losing what matters. Prototyping a product? We'll suggest cheaper materials for the first few iterations and switch to the final material only when the design is locked in.

Frequently asked questions

What file format should I send?+

STL and STEP are ideal. We also accept OBJ, 3MF, IGES, and native SolidWorks and Fusion 360 files. If you only have photos or a sketch, we can build the CAD model for you as part of the quote.

How strong are 3D-printed parts?+

Very strong when specified correctly. Carbon-fiber-reinforced FDM parts can rival cast aluminum in stiffness. We tune infill and wall count to the actual load your part will see, and we're happy to advise on material selection.
